Product Attributes
- Product Status: Obsolete
- Core Processor: ARM® Cortex®-A8
- Number of Cores/Bus Width: 1 Core, 32-Bit
- Speed: 800MHz
- Co-Processors/DSP: Multimedia; NEON™ SIMD
- RAM Controllers: LPDDR2, DDR2, DDR3
- Graphics Acceleration: Yes
- Display & Interface Controllers: Keypad, LCD
- Ethernet: 10/100Mbps (1)
- SATA: SATA 1.5Gbps (1)
- USB: USB 2.0 (2), USB 2.0 + PHY (2)
- Voltage - I/O: 1.3V, 1.8V, 2.775V, 3.3V
- Operating Temperature: -40°C ~ 125°C (TJ)
- Security Features: ARM TZ, Boot Security, Cryptography, RTIC, Secure Fusebox, Secure JTAG, Secure Memory, Secure RTC, Tamper Detection
- Package / Case: 529-FBGA
- Supplier Device Package: 529-FBGA (19x19)
